Nonagon - A polygon having nine angles and nine sides.
Nonagenarian - A person who is from 90 to 99 years old.
Nonahedron - Any of the 2,606 topologically distinct convex polyhefra that have nine faces.

Octagon - A polygon having eight angles and eight sides.
Octosyllabic - Consisting of or pertaining to eight syllables.
Octastyle - Having eight columns in the front, as a temple or portico.

Heptagon - A polygon having seven angles and seven sides.
Heptahedron - A solid figure have seven faces.
Heptameter - A verse of seven metrical feet.

Hexagon - A polygon having six angles and six sides.
Hexagonal - Having six sides and six angles.
Hexagram - A six-pointed starlike figure formed of two equilateral triangles placed concentrically with each side of a triangle parallel to a side of the other and on opposite sides of the center.

Pentateuch - First five books of the Old Testament: Genesis, Exodus, Leviticus, Numbers, and Deuteronomy.
Pentagon - A polygon having five angles and five sides.
Pentafid - Divided or cleft into five parts.

Tetrabranchiate - Belonging or pertaining to the Nautiloidea, a subclass or order of cephalopods with four gills, including the pearly nautilus and numerous fossel forms.
Tetragon - A polygon having four angles or sides; a quadrangle or quadrilateral.
Tetraploidy - Having a chromosome number that is four times the basic or haploid number.

Diagonal - Connecting two nonadjacent angles or vertices of a polygon or polyhedron, as a straight line.
Diameter -   a straight line connecting the centre of a geometric figure, esp a circle or sphere, with two points on the perimeter or surface.

Dichromatic - Also, dichroic. having or showing two colors; dichromic.
Dichromacy - A deficiency of color vision in which the person can match any given hue by mixing only two other two other wavelengths of light (as opposed to the three wavelengts needed by people with normal color vision).
Dichroism - Pleochroism of a uniaxial crystal such that it exhibits two different colors when viewed from two different directions under transmitted light.

Monotheism - The doctrine or belief that there is only one God.
Monotheistic - The doctrine that there is only one God.
Monothematic - Having a single theme.
